Two women accused of working with a former San Mateo County correctional officer and another woman to provide two cellphones and drugs to a relative serving time in county jail took plea deals Monday and are facing probation and jail sentences, according to the San Mateo County District Attorney’s Office.

The sister of former inmate Dionicio Lopez, 30-year-old Amanda Lopez and her 60-year-old mother, Leticia Lopez, pleaded no contest to felony conspiracy and misdemeanor illegal communication with an inmate, respectively. Amanda Lopez was sentenced to three years supervised probation and 45 days county jail, and Leticia Lopez was sentenced to two years court probation and five days county jail, according to prosecutors.
